Hyundai i-30: Lighting / Interior lights
NOTICE
Do not use the interior lights for
extended periods when the engine
is turned off otherwise the battery
will discharge.
WARNING
Do not use the interior lights
when driving in the dark.The interior
lights may obscure your view
and cause an accident.
Interior lamp AUTO cut
The interior lamps will automatically
go off approximately 20 minutes after
the engine is turned off and the
doors are closed. If a door is opened,
the lamp will go off 40 minutes after
the engine is turned off. If the doors
are locked and the vehicle enters the
armed stage of the theft alarm system,
the lamps will go off five seconds
later.
